5 min read“If their response is no, it will be highly unfortunate and make their intentions clear.” That line, delivered by Secretary of State Marco Rubio in a press conference shortly after Ukraine agreed to a US-proposed 30-day ceasefire, is the hinge on which this episode of Asmongold TV turns. The host and his co-commentator break down the press conference in real time, working through what it means that the ball is now in Russia’s court—and what happens if Russia simply says no.
The ceasefire proposal as a test of intentions
The core argument of the episode is that the US-brokered ceasefire proposal is less a peace plan than a diagnostic tool. Rubio explains that the US brought the proposal directly to Ukraine, which accepted it unconditionally. Now the question is whether Russia will do the same. The commentators note that Ukraine had little choice but to agree: with US military aid frozen, they were in a weak position. As one says, “If they know America's not going to keep giving them aid, they're fucked.” The ceasefire gives Ukraine a way to stop the bleeding while appearing cooperative.
